I've never read The Life of Pi. What's it about? Is it worth reading? It strikes me that it may found in the same bookstore section as The Alchemist, which I loved ... is that a fair guess ... going solely on the couple of pictures posted here.
-
Re: The Upcoming Films Thread
the novel is worth checking out thorpe. in the right hands it's also ripe for adaptation though, and with lee and the guy who wrote finding neverland, it's a safe bet that the film won't let down so you could also just wait for that.
the alchemist is a good comparison, i reckon if you like one you'll probably like the other. i liked em both anyway. life of pi isn't anywhere near as abstract as alchemist, the personal journey of the main character mostly about exploring christianity, judaism, and islam... the first half anyway. then it kind of spirals into an adventure fantasy story at which point the plot really takes off. lots of great material re truth v perspective, and martel does a terrific job keeping the reader guessing.
